Las Vegas real estate has surged as retirees, remote workers, and Californians priced out of the coast flock to Nevada's lack of state income tax and lower cost of living. Las Vegas homes for sale span master-planned communities like Summerlin to condo towers along the Strip.

Common questions about home buying, market prices, and investing in Las Vegas
No state income tax, significantly lower home prices than California, and a short flight or drive back to the coast have made Las Vegas a top relocation destination for Californians.
Strong population growth and steady tourism-driven rental demand, especially near the Strip and Henderson, support both long-term and short-term rental investment strategies.
